Separators for power plants
Ensure a reliable power supply by treating fuel and lube oils with precision separators, minimizing corrosion and maximizing efficiency across all operational conditions.

The OSE separator generation from GEA is a centrifugal separation equipment engineered to optimize fuel and lube oil treatment in power plant operations. It excels in impurity removal and corrosion prevention, ensuring the longevity and efficiency of turbines and diesel engines. Utilizing high g-force separation, it effectively processes a variety of challenging feedstocks, making it indispensable for cleaning diesel, natural gas, and turbine oils. With a throughput capacity of up to 80 m³/h per unit, it is built for continuous, high-speed, and automated operations. The unitrolplus sensor system provides automatic monitoring and control, maximizing operational reliability and allowing unsupervised use. Engineered with robust materials for durability in harsh environments, the OSE separator also promises lower maintenance with extended service intervals. Tailoring configurations for specific needs, GEA offers engineering support to ensure seamless integration into existing systems.
